The importance of water (1)
Water is the common name applied to the liquid form (state) of the hydrogen and oxygen compound h20. Pure water is an odourless, tasteless, clear liquid. Water is one of nature’s most gifts to mankind. Essential to life, a person’s survival depends on drinking water. Water is one of the most essential elements to good health. It is necessary for the digestion and absorbtion of flood helps maintain proper muscle tone; supplies oxygen and nutrients to the cells; rids the body of wastes; and serves as a natural air conditioning system. Health officials emphasize the importance of drinking at least eight glasses of clean water each and every day to maintain good health.

Since water contains no calories and can serve as an appetite suppressant and helps the body metabolize stored fat, it may possibly be one of the most significant factors in losing weight. In his book, titled “Snowbird Diet” Dr.Donald Robertson says the body will not function properly without enough water and discuss the importance of drinking plenty of water for permanent weight loss.” Drinking enough water is the best treatment for fluids retention; the overweight person needs more water than the thin one; water helps to maintain proper muscle tone; water can help relieve constipation; drinking water is essential to weight loss”

Water is a key component in determining the quality of our lives. Today people are concerned about the quality of the water they drink.
